The telecom industry's unique challenge lies in the complexity of customer data across multiple touchpoints. Unlike retail ecommerce where a customer either bought or didn't, telecom customers exist in constant flux — upgrading plans, adding family members, purchasing accessories, scheduling service calls, and managing multiple connected devices. When your email marketing tools can't access real-time data from your customer management system, you miss critical moments like sending a retention offer to someone who just called to cancel, or promoting device insurance to someone who just reported a cracked screen. Common integration mistakes cost telecom companies thousands in missed opportunities. We've seen campaigns where upgrade offers went to customers who upgraded last week, family plan promotions targeted single-line accounts, and device protection emails hit customers who already had coverage. These errors happen because most email templates rely on static segmentation rules rather than dynamic, real-time customer state. The revenue impact compounds: a mistimed message doesn't just fail to convert, it can actively damage the relationship. When someone receives an offer for a service they already have, it signals that the company doesn't know them, eroding the trust essential for telecom customer retention. However, it's important to note that platform integration alone isn't enough — A/B testing with real audience segments remains essential for validating that your connected data translates into engagement with your specific customer base. The good news is that proper integration gives you better data for those tests. When you can segment by actual usage patterns, billing history, and service interactions rather than just demographics, your test results become more actionable and your winning variations deliver more sustainable lift. What are best practices for telecom ecommerce platform emails?
Best practices include segmenting your list by purchase history and plan type, using urgency only when genuine (limited-time offers, stock levels), including product images with alt text for accessibility, testing your email on major clients like Gmail and Outlook before sending, and always including an unsubscribe link to maintain sender reputation. How long should a telecom ecommerce platform email be?
Telecom ecommerce platform emails perform best between 100 and 150 words of body copy, plus a subject line under 50 characters. This length is short enough to display fully on mobile without excessive scrolling, yet long enough to convey product details and urgency. Emails exceeding 200 words see a 12% decline in click-through rates.
